One of the well-known landmarks in Elenski Balkan (a specific part of Stara Planina Mountain) area is Hristovski waterfall. The waterfall was named a protected area in 1974. Hristovski waterfall is situated at an altitude of 400 m south of Hristovtsi district of Rouhovtsi village.
An eco path leads to Miykovska River and the waterfall. Shelters, benches and a barbecue have been set up to allow tourists to take a break.
The western wall features vertical cliffs and with the aid of instructors you can go down the rocks of the waterfall itself. Using Alpine climbing equipment, tourists can follow the several paths in the region.
A steep slope goes down the left side of the river. This slope is covered in dense forests, while the right side features a meadow. A sign reminds visitors that they have entered a protected area.
The waterfall has been named a landmark and a protected area in order to preserve the landscape and the beautiful natural phenomenon untouched.
